In the fall of 2007, a quirky, sensitive girl named Hannah had a crush on an insensitive jerk. And I was her father. In the summer of 1984, a quirky, sensitive girl named Emily had a crush on an insensitive jerk. And I was that jerk. Loosely based on a true story (well, several, actually) "The Idiot Who Ran Into A Tree" is a comedic, bittersweet tale of parenting, teen angst, summer camp and a quarrelsome oak. All the names have been changed. The nicknames, however, have stayed the same.

THE YEAR is 1968 and the Swinging Sixties are still swinging - though not in Ireland. But wait! An old woman dies in a northern Irish town and her wake becomes a rendezvous for lesbians, bisexuals and political revolutionaries. And in there among them all is Jeremiah Coffey, lonely Jeremiah, an innocent abroad in his own country and hopelessly in love with the beautiful Aisling who swings both ways. And all this in holy Ireland. Hold on to your hats!
